Natural Gas Burner By Application
Industrial Natural Gas Burners
The industrial segment of the natural gas burner market is one of the largest and most significant applications due to the widespread use of natural gas burners in manufacturing, production facilities, and large-scale operations. These burners are essential in industries like chemical, petrochemical, cement, food processing, and pharmaceuticals, where controlled heating and temperature regulation are critical. Industrial burners are designed for high efficiency, long service life, and safety under extreme operating conditions. With industries increasingly focusing on reducing carbon footprints and improving energy efficiency, the adoption of advanced burners that utilize natural gas is on the rise, further driving market growth.
Furthermore, natural gas burners in the industrial sector are being integrated with automation and control systems, enabling remote monitoring and optimized energy use. This trend contributes to the reduction of operational costs while enhancing overall productivity. The push toward environmentally-friendly manufacturing practices is also propelling the adoption of cleaner fuels, such as natural gas, in industrial heating applications. Consequently, the industrial segment continues to dominate the natural gas burner market, with projections for growth as industries move towards more sustainable practices and energy-efficient technologies.
Residential Natural Gas Burners
In the residential segment, natural gas burners are primarily used for cooking and heating. These applications have become increasingly popular as natural gas is considered an affordable and reliable energy source for homes. Homeowners benefit from the ability to use natural gas burners for various purposes, including stoves, ovens, water heaters, and furnaces. The residential segment is expected to experience substantial growth as more households transition to natural gas to take advantage of its cost-effectiveness and lower environmental impact compared to traditional electric or oil-based systems.
The trend towards energy-efficient appliances in homes is also bolstering the demand for residential natural gas burners. These burners are designed to optimize fuel consumption, reduce emissions, and provide consumers with a sustainable heating and cooking solution. Additionally, the increasing availability of natural gas in urban areas and the availability of rebates and incentives for energy-efficient appliance upgrades are further driving the growth of natural gas burners in residential applications. As consumers become more environmentally conscious and seek cost-effective solutions, the adoption of natural gas burners in homes is expected to rise steadily.
Commercial Natural Gas Burners
In the commercial sector, natural gas burners are widely used in applications such as heating, hot water production, and cooking, particularly in establishments like restaurants, hotels, and hospitals. The demand for natural gas burners in this sector is driven by the need for energy-efficient, cost-effective solutions that ensure the smooth operation of these facilities. Commercial burners are often designed to meet the high demand for heating and hot water in these establishments while minimizing energy wastage. This is particularly important in the commercial foodservice industry, where gas burners are used for cooking, offering high precision and control in temperature regulation.
The commercial natural gas burner market is also influenced by regulatory requirements and a growing emphasis on sustainability. Many commercial establishments are adopting natural gas burners as part of their efforts to reduce their carbon footprint, as natural gas is a cleaner alternative to coal and oil-based heating systems. Furthermore, commercial burners are being designed to meet specific requirements in terms of efficiency and emissions, ensuring that businesses comply with environmental standards. As the commercial sector increasingly embraces energy-efficient technologies, the demand for natural gas burners is expected to continue rising in this application area.

One of the key trends in the natural gas burner market is the growing demand for energy-efficient solutions. As energy costs rise globally and environmental concerns become more prominent, both residential and commercial users are opting for natural gas burners that offer higher efficiency and reduced emissions. Burner manufacturers are continually developing advanced technologies, such as modulating burners and electronic ignition systems, to optimize fuel consumption while maintaining high-performance standards. These innovations are contributing to the increased adoption of natural gas burners in both the industrial and consumer markets, as they offer long-term savings and environmental benefits.
Another important trend is the integration of natural gas burners with smart technologies and IoT systems. This trend allows for remote monitoring, predictive maintenance, and energy management, making it easier to optimize burner performance. For instance, many industrial facilities now incorporate automated control systems to adjust burner settings based on real-time data, improving efficiency and safety. This technological advancement is also being applied in residential and commercial sectors, where consumers are increasingly demanding smarter, more connected solutions for energy management and home automation. As smart technology becomes more prevalent, it is expected to drive further growth in the natural gas burner market.

1. What is the main application of natural gas burners? Natural gas burners are used primarily in industrial, residential, and commercial applications for heating, cooking, and hot water production.
2. How does a natural gas burner work? A natural gas burner operates by mixing natural gas with air to create a controlled flame for heating or cooking purposes.
3. What are the advantages of using natural gas burners over electric ones? Natural gas burners offer lower operating costs, faster heating times, and lower emissions compared to electric burners.
4. Are natural gas burners more environmentally friendly than other fuel types? Yes, natural gas burns cleaner than coal and oil, emitting fewer pollutants and greenhouse gases.
5. What industries use natural gas burners? Natural gas burners are widely used in industries like chemicals, food processing, cement production, and pharmaceuticals.
6. How can I maintain my natural gas burner? Regular maintenance involves cleaning the burner, checking the gas line for leaks, and inspecting the ignition system for efficiency.
7. What is the life expectancy of a natural gas burner? With proper maintenance, a natural gas burner can last between 10 to 15 years.
8. How can natural gas burners be more energy-efficient? Using modulating burners, optimizing air-fuel mixtures, and integrating smart control systems can improve burner efficiency.
9. Is natural gas available everywhere for burner use? Natural gas availability depends on infrastructure; urban areas usually have easy access, while rural areas may require specific installations.
10. Can natural gas burners be used for both residential and commercial applications? Yes, natural gas burners are designed for use in both residential homes for heating and cooking, and in commercial establishments like restaurants and hotels.
